Stop Building Portals. Start Building Patient Experiences.
A conventional patient portal is usually organized around internal systems: records live in one area, billing in another, and appointment tools somewhere else. A patient experience should instead be organized around what a person is trying to accomplish before, during, and after care.
That shift changes what the product team prioritizes. Every screen should reduce uncertainty, surface the next useful action, and make an important task easier to complete.
- Frictionless onboarding: Use secure identity verification and familiar biometric options, such as Face ID or Touch ID, where the platform supports them.
- Action-oriented dashboards: Prioritize the next meaningful task, whether that is joining a telehealth visit, completing a form, or following a medication reminder.
- Motivation designed into the experience: Apply progress cues, challenges, and other behavioral patterns when they support a real health goal rather than adding decoration.

Move From Chatbots to Agentic Patient Workflows
A chatbot can answer a question. An agentic workflow can coordinate several approved actions across systems. For example, a patient looking for a specialist may need to filter by location and insurance, compare availability, reserve a time, and complete intake information. A well-designed agent can help orchestrate that sequence instead of forcing the patient to restart at every handoff.
The strongest use cases are bounded, observable, and reversible. Teams should define what the agent is allowed to do, which systems it may access, when it must ask for confirmation, and when the task needs a person. That is the practical difference between automation and a trustworthy agentic application.
Keep people in control
Patient-facing AI should support decisions and complete approved administrative work without presenting unverified medical advice as fact. Escalation paths, consent, auditability, and clinical governance belong in the workflow from the start.
Connect the Experience to Secure Healthcare Systems
A beautiful interface cannot create a coherent experience if appointment, eligibility, referral, identity, and clinical data remain disconnected. The product needs a secure integration layer that can translate a patient request into controlled actions across the systems responsible for fulfilling it.
That architecture has to account for privacy, cybersecurity, resilience, access controls, and operational visibility. In healthcare, those qualities are not separate from UX. They determine whether the experience is dependable enough for patients and staff to trust.

Use Patient Self-Service to Reduce Administrative Load
A patient engagement application should create value on both sides of the interaction. When patients can upload an insurance card, complete intake, understand their next step, or route a non-urgent request digitally, staff spend less time on repeatable coordination and more time on work that requires judgment.
AI-assisted triage and message routing can extend that model, but success should be measured in operational terms: fewer avoidable calls, faster routing, higher task completion, and clear escalation when a digital workflow cannot safely continue.
- Start with one high-friction journey and map every patient, staff, system, and approval handoff.
- Separate the experience problem from the integration, security, and governance constraints underneath it.
- Choose a measurable first release before expanding the agent's responsibilities or the number of connected systems.

01What is patient engagement in healthcare?
Patient engagement is the design of digital and human touchpoints that help people understand what to do next, complete important tasks, and participate in their care before, during, and after a visit.
02How is a patient experience different from a traditional patient portal?
A traditional portal is often organized around internal systems such as records, billing, and appointments. A patient experience is organized around the person’s journey and brings the next useful action into a clearer, more coherent flow.
03How can agentic AI improve patient engagement?
Agentic AI can coordinate approved administrative steps across systems, such as finding a specialist, checking eligibility, comparing availability, reserving a time, and completing intake. The workflow should request confirmation when needed and hand the task to a person when automation is not appropriate.
04What should a patient engagement app include?
Useful patient engagement apps typically combine secure onboarding, an action-oriented dashboard, clear next steps, self-service tasks, and accessible paths to human support. Each feature should reduce uncertainty or make a meaningful task easier to complete.
05How can healthcare organizations keep patient-facing AI safe?
Define bounded permissions, approved data access, confirmation points, consent requirements, audit trails, and human escalation paths before deployment. Patient-facing AI should support decisions and administrative work without presenting unverified medical advice as fact.
06How does patient self-service reduce administrative workload?
Self-service moves repeatable tasks—such as insurance-card uploads, intake, appointment preparation, and non-urgent request routing—into clear digital workflows. That can reduce avoidable calls and allow staff to spend more time on work that requires judgment.
